Meseichuk
Meseichuk is a peak in Parem Municipality, Chuuk and has an elevation of 38 metres.Places of Interest

Eot
Islet
Eot is an island and municipality in the state of Chuuk, Federated States of Micronesia. It is Northeast of Udot, another Micronesian island. Eot belongs to the Faichuk Islands group. It has a land area of 49 hectares.
Param
Island
Param is a municipality and an island in the Southern Nomoneas Islands of Chuuk, Federated States of Micronesia. Param municipality consists of Param Island, Totiw Island and Oan Island.
